About the role
As a Teaching Assistant, you'll work alongside teachers to provide targeted support-both one-to-one and in small groups-across all ages, being flexible to support Early Years through to Year 6. To do this effectively, we expect candidates to already have relevant school experience. You'll assist with lesson delivery, support positive behaviours, prepare resources, and ensure our classroom environments are stimulating, safe, and inclusive. You'll also have opportunities to support trips and out-of-school activities.

We value the skills and dedication of our teaching assistants. To support the best outcomes for our students, we require applicants to hold at least a Level 2 Teaching Assistant qualification; ideally Level 3. If you're working towards a level 3 qualification, we'll support your journey through our Teaching Assistant Apprenticeship Programme, helping you develop the skills and confidence to make an even greater impact.

Skills and Experience we would like to see:

* Level 3 Teaching Assistant qualification (or currently working towards it)
* Experience supporting children in both Key Stage 1 and Key Stage 2
* Knowledge of strategies to support pupils with SEND
* Familiarity with phonics programmes such as Read Write Inc
* Understanding of child development and how children learn
* Confidence using digital tools to support learning and communication
* Positive behaviour management experience
* A flexible, proactive approach and a genuine passion for primary education
* UK right to work, as this role is not eligible for sponsorship.

Lift St Helen's is based in Monk Bretton village, a small community easily reached from Wakefield, Barnsley, Rotherham and Sheffield. Here at Lift St Helen's, we are a proud member of Lift Schools.

Leadership at our school is forward-thinking - and the well-being and work-life balance of our teachers is very important. We give autonomy to teachers, we have a shared ethos around curriculum, marking and feedback, which each teacher applies with their own style and personal teacher pedagogy.

We want you to give us your best and our non-negotiables are outstanding attainment and progress for every child, coupled with kindness and warm-heartedness, not what colour pen you use to mark books! Our school has been recently refurbished and is a modern, bright and attractive place for us all to work.
